Description

Subtract mean rest spectrum from mean task spectrum after applying optimal linebroadening to the mean task spectrum. Usually used to correct for the BOLD lineshape narrowing effect in 1H fMRS data.

Usage

subtract_rest_task(mrs_data, task_vec, xlim = c(2.11, 1.91))

Arguments

mrs_data

dynamic MRS data.

task_vec

a logical vector with the same length and dynamic scans. Elements set to TRUE and FALSE will be assigned to task and rest respectively.

xlim

spectral region to match, eg c(2.11, 1.91) for tNAA region.

Value

a list containing the matched mrs_data, difference spectra and optimisation results.
